#316dfc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#316dfc is composed of 19.2% red, 42.7%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 222.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 59%. #316dfc color hex could be obtained by blending #62daff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#316dfc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#316dfc has RGB values of R:49, G:109,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3239420.

Shades and Tints of #316dfc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000207 is the darkest color, while #f2f6ff is the lightest one.
